Steps to Enable Wi-Fi Calling on iPhone
If you're experiencing weak cellular signals or want to enhance your call quality, you can effortlessly set up Wi-Fi calling on your iPhone. Here's a comprehensive guide to get you started:1. Access your iPhone's settings by tapping the "Settings" icon. Select "Phone" and then navigate to "Wi-Fi Calling."
2. Ensure "Wi-Fi Calling" is enabled by toggling the switch to the "On" position.
3. If you have a Dual SIM iPhone, choose the desired line from the "SIMs" section.
4. Select "Wi-Fi Calling" and activate "Wi-Fi Calling on This iPhone."
5. Provide or confirm your emergency address. This information allows emergency services to locate you if you need assistance.
Remember, not all Wi-Fi networks support Wi-Fi calling. If you're facing connectivity issues, try connecting to a different Wi-Fi network. Additionally, if you disable Wi-Fi calling, you can still make calls while connected to Wi-Fi but will rely solely on your cellular signal.
